Subject: DupeSweep 3.2 rollout — customer record deduplication

Team, the merge-confidence threshold has been raised in this release, so fewer automatic merges will occur and more candidates will land in the review queue. Please set expectations with customers accordingly. Rollbacks are possible within 48 hours of a merge. When filing a support case about an unexpected merge, attach the build token printed below.

pipeline stamp: htk9_ce63042d9

Subject: Profile store handover

Hi Marek,

Before I roll off, a note for the plugin authors: the Veldora user-profile store is now sharded by account hash across four nodes. Plugins should route reads through the shard resolver, never directly. Rebalancing runs Sundays, expect brief replica lag. Plugin sandboxes connect to the read replica using the string below.

primary connection of kawep-yafop = mssql://briion_svc:9sCH3kS@db-24ce.orvexcloud.internal:5432/ulair

### Runbook: BounceBroom — Account Recovery

If the BounceBroom email bounce processor loses access to its service account, do not create a new one. First, pause the intake queue so bounces buffer safely. Then open the recovery console and select the BounceBroom principal. Verification requires approval from the on-call lead. Once approved, the console prompts for the stored recovery credentials; enter the passphrase that appears directly below this paragraph.

recovery phrase for fahof-kahap: holion-gormir-jorix-istix-briwyn-sorael

- [ ] **Step 7: Breaker override escrow.** After sealing the signing keys for the Tallgrove upstream API circuit breaker, confirm the support team can force the breaker open during a full outage. The override bundle lives in the sealed escrow drawer and is useless without its unlock phrase. Two ceremony witnesses must initial this step before proceeding. The escrow bundle is decrypted with the recovery passphrase that follows.

vault phrase of kahip-kahop = holath-quenmir

Handover: Nightfill Scheduler

The Nightfill scheduler kicks off backfills at 02:00 local and retries failed partitions twice before paging. Config lives in the Driftbay repo; most support tickets are stale lock files, which clear with the reset script. Don't restart mid-run — let the current partition finish. I'm rotating off this service at the end of the week, so route any escalations to the new owner listed below.

approver of faduf-bagug = Framir Sorwyn